Basavanahalli in context
With 544 people at the 2011 Census, Basavanahalli was the 555th most populous of its district's 1117 villages, below the district average of 804.
The sex ratio was 1007 women per 1,000 men (level with the district's rural figure of 1008)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1160, 237 above the rural national 923.
